OXY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2014 in Review
1,159 of the 3,481 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Occidental Petroleum (OXY) for Q2 2014, worth a combined $65.3B — up 7.9% from $60.5B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 111 funds opened new OXY positions and 54 closed out — a net gain of 57 holders — while 483 added to existing stakes and 408 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Norges Bank, adding an estimated $597M. The largest seller was Wellington Management Group, cutting an estimated $352M.
